Residential window repl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new ones to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a home. This process typically includes evaluating existing window conditions, selecting suitable replacement options, and carefully installing the new units to ensure a proper fit. Skilled contractors focus on minimizing disruptions during installation while ensuring the new windows enhance the overall comfort and aesthetic of the property. Homeowners can work with local service providers to choose from a variety of window styles, materials, and features that best match their home's design and their personal preferences.
This service helps address several common problems faced by homeowners. For example, old or broken windows can lead to drafts, making indoor spaces less comfortable and increasing energy costs. Windows that are cracked, foggy, or difficult to open may compromise security and ventilation. In addition, outdated windows can negatively impact a home’s curb appeal, especially if they no longer match the property's style. Replacing these windows can resolve these issues, resulting in a more secure, energy-efficient, and visually appealing home.

The overview below groups typical Residential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kearney,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window replacements, such as a single pane or small size,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on window type and materials used.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Full Replacement - Replacing multiple windows or standard-sized units usually costs between $1,000-$3,500. Local contractors often handle these projects regularly within this range, with larger homes or premium materials pushing costs higher.
Larger or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ex window replacement jobs, such as custom sizes or multiple stories, can reach $4,000-$8,000 or more. These projects are less common but typically involve additional structural work or premium features.
High-End or Specialty Installations - High-end window replacements, including custom designs or energy-efficient models, can exceed $10,000. Such projects are less frequent and usually involve premium materials, special features, or extensive customization.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for residential window repl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to the one at hand.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a track record of successfully completing window replacements in homes comparable in size and style within the Kearney, MO area. This experience can indicate familiarity with local building codes, common challenges, and the specific needs of homes in the community, helping 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ets expectations.
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any other relevant details.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It also allows for easier comparison between different service providers, making it simpler to identify which contractor’s approach aligns best with the homeowner’s preferences and requirements.
Reputable references and effective communication are key factors in choosing a dependable cont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ients who had similar window replacement projects. Contacting these references can provide insights into the contractor’s reliability, quality of work, and professionalism. Additionally, good communication-such as prompt responses to questions and clarity about the process-can foster a positive working relationship and help ensure the project progresses without unnecessary issues.
